Understanding Chlorophyll Liquid Benefits
Chlorophyll is the green pigment found in plants that makes photosynthesis possible β it's how plants convert sunlight into energy. But this remarkable molecule does more than nourish plant life. In supplement form, Chlorophyll has been valued for decades for its ability to support natural blood-cleansing processes, encourage a healthy immune response, and act as a natural internal deodorizer.
Most Liquid Chlorophyll supplements β including Nature's Sunshine Liquid Chlorophyll β use sodium copper chlorophyllin, a water-soluble derivative of natural Chlorophyll. While Chlorophyll in its natural state is fat-soluble and doesn't dissolve cleanly in water, chlorophyllin was developed specifically to be water-soluble, making it easy to stir into a glass of cold water and enjoy daily.
Structurally, sodium copper chlorophyllin retains the porphyrin ring system found in natural Chlorophyll but replaces the central magnesium atom with copper and removes the phytol tail. This modification improves stability and prevents the color change from green to brown that natural Chlorophyll can undergo. Both the FDA and EFSA recognize Chlorophyll-based compounds as safe for use in foods.

Detoxification and Carcinogen Binding
Research suggests that Chlorophyll and sodium copper chlorophyllin are able to form tight molecular complexes with certain chemicals known or suspected to cause harm β including polyaromatic hydrocarbons found in tobacco smoke and aflatoxin B1. In a landmark randomized, placebo-controlled trial, chlorophyllin taken three times daily led to a 55% reduction in urinary aflatoxin-DNA adduct biomarkers compared to placebo. This carcinogen-binding ability may help reduce the amount of harmful compounds that reach susceptible tissues.
Natural Deodorizing
Chlorophyll has been marketed as an internal deodorant since the 1950s. One study found that administration of chlorophyllin was helpful in controlling body and fecal odors in 62 geriatric nursing home patients. Another study in patients with trimethylaminuria found that oral sodium copper chlorophyllin significantly decreased urinary trimethylamine. While modern evidence in healthy individuals is limited, the traditional use is well established and spans more than 50 years without serious side effects reported.

It's important to note that the safety of Chlorophyll or chlorophyllin supplements has not been tested in pregnant or lactating women, so these supplements should be avoided during pregnancy and lactation. Individuals with rare disorders of copper metabolism, such as Wilson's disease, should also limit exposure to copper-containing supplements including sodium copper chlorophyllin.

When taken orally, chlorophyllin may cause green discoloration of urine or feces, or yellow or black discoloration of the tongue. These are harmless cosmetic effects and not a cause for concern. There have also been occasional reports of mild digestive changes related to oral use. Chlorophyllin may result in false positive results on guaiac card tests for occult blood β be sure to let your healthcare provider know if you're using this supplement before any such testing.

Can Liquid Chlorophyll support detoxification?
Research suggests chlorophyllin can form tight molecular complexes with certain harmful compounds β including aflatoxin B1 and polyaromatic hydrocarbons found in tobacco smoke β potentially reducing their absorption in the gastrointestinal tract. A randomized, placebo-controlled trial found chlorophyllin reduced urinary aflatoxin-DNA adduct biomarkers by 55% compared to placebo. It has also been documented to modulate liver detoxification enzyme systems, including phase 2 cytoprotective genes. While these findings provide a scientific basis for specific toxin binding, the broader concept of a 'whole body cleanse' via Chlorophyll is rooted primarily in traditional use and naturopathic practice.
